As funções não são limitadas a ter apenas um parâmetro, podem ter infinitos parâmetros.
Programa exemplo
Neste programa, a função print_coordinates() tem dois parâmetros x e y (aceita dois argumentos).
Então, quando chamada, neste caso com os argumentos 420 e 69, os dois serão atribuídos a cada parâmetro, de modo a fazer o output:
Programa exemplo
#include <iostream> using namespace std; void print_coordinates(int x, int y){ cout << "X: " << x << endl; cout << "Y: " << y << endl; } int main() { print_coordinates(420, 69); }
Neste programa, a função print_coordinates() tem dois parâmetros x e y (aceita dois argumentos).
Então, quando chamada, neste caso com os argumentos 420 e 69, os dois serão atribuídos a cada parâmetro, de modo a fazer o output:
X: 420 Y: 69
Sem comentários:
Enviar um comentário
Comente de forma construtiva...
Nota: só um membro deste blogue pode publicar um comentário.